摘要
The preparation of B4C by SHS in B2O3-Mg-C system was investigated in this study. In the preparation of B4C, the effect on reactivity and reaction products of the initial pressure of inert gas in reactor, the content of Mg and C in mixture was investigated. The minimum initial pressure of inert gas in reactor for SHS reaction in this system was 25 atm, and as the pressure increased, the concentration of unreacted Mg decreased and combustion temperature increased. At the initial inert gas pressure in reactor of 25 atm, the optimum composition for the preparation of pure B4C was 2B(2)O(3) + 6.3Mg + 0.94C. The B4C synthesized in this condition had an irregular shape and the particle size of 1 similar to 3 gm.
